Rose and Rosie
British YouTubers and comedy duo
Rose Ellen Dix (born 15 June 1988)[1] and Rosie Spaughton (born 30 May 1990)[2] are a marriedBritish comedy and entertainment duo who have gained popularity through their YouTube videos.

[edit]YouTube
[edit]Rose Dix joined YouTube for a university class, establishing the Rose Ellen Dix channel.[9] She uploaded her first video, entitled "Rose Dix talks Lisa Scinta," on 30 September 2010. An early assignment during her film degree included attempting to make a video go viral. Dix posted a parody of Kesha's Tik Tok on 26 January 2011, and the video received an estimated 16,000 views in five days.[10][11]
Rosie Spaughton uploaded her first video, entitled "YDAHD," to her channel TheRoxetera, on 19 December 2011. She first appears on the Rose Ellen Dix channel in "Baffle Laffle Taffle Breakup" posted on 18 December 2011. Their first posted collaboration video was uploaded on 15 January 2012 to the Rose Ellen Dix channel.
